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- Whether the proposal would meet the exceptions for holiday accommodation sites, with particular regard to (i) the character and appearance of the area; and (ii) the viability of the business
What decided it
The proposal conflicted with development plan policies requiring holiday accommodation to deliver substantial public benefits outweighing harm to the open rural character and to be demonstrably viable in the long term, with neither criterion satisfied.
The limited public and economic benefits of the proposal did not outweigh the substantial harm to the open rural character and appearance of the countryside and the failure to demonstrate business viability.
Plan policies cited: SP4, EP9, CDMP3, CDMP4
